Besoh

Pronunciation

  • /goː/

Etymology 1

Inherited from Proto-South-Andusian *goː, from Proto-Andusian *ᵑgao (“louse”).

Noun

  1. louse
  2. vermin of skin and hair
  3. (by extension) any tiny biting pest

Etymology 2

Inherited from Proto-South-Andusian *gɔː, from Proto-Andusian *gɔɛ (“say”).

Verb

  1. say, speak
  2. tell
